FCC Section 7 Proposal Comment Dates Corrected; VRS, FAA Antenna, Billing PRA Dates Set
Comment deadlines were corrected on FCC proposals to implement Section 7 of the Communications Act and speed review of new technologies and services. Comments are due May 21, replies June 20 in docket 18-22, said a correction Wednesday in the…

Federal Register that said an earlier notice (see 1804040021) inaccurately reflected shorter deadlines than the 45-day and 75-day deadlines in the NPRM. Three other FR notices said Paperwork Reduction Act comments are due: May 11 at the FCC and Office of Management and Budget on revised video relay service certification information collection requirements in docket 03-123 (here), and on third-party disclosure obligations under Section 17.4 rules, requiring "the owner of any proposed or existing antenna structure that requires notice of proposed construction to the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) to register the structure with FCC," among other duties (here); and June 11 at the FCC on truth-in-billing and anti-cramming requirements in dockets 98-170 and 04-208 (here).
